Filippo Focacci is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ering and Management Science and Operations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Filippo Focacci has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 193 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Computer Networks and Communications, 6 papers in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ering and 3 papers in Management Science and Operations Research. Recurrent topics in Filippo Focacci’s work include Distributed Constraint Optimization Problems and Algorithms (7 papers), Vehicle Routing Optimization Methods (5 papers) and Scheduling and Timetabling Solutions (3 papers). Filippo Focacci is often cited by papers focused on Distributed Constraint Optimization Problems and Algorithms (7 papers), Vehicle Routing Optimization Methods (5 papers) and Scheduling and Timetabling Solutions (3 papers). Filippo Focacci collaborates with scholars based in Italy and Canada. Filippo Focacci's co-authors include Michela Milano, Andrea Lodi, Gilles Pesant, Louis-Martin Rousseau, Michel Gendreau, Daniele Vigo, Paolo Toth, Alberto Caprara, Evelina Lamma and Paola Mello and has published in prestigious journals such as Annals of Operations Research, INFORMS journal on computing and Software Practice and Experience.
